This is an official California Judicial Council form requesting a protective order in a case of elderly adult abuse. Enter the information as indicated on the form and file with the court as appropriate.

The Norwalk California Request for Elder or Dependent Adult Abuse Restraining Orders, also known as Elder or Dependent Adult Abuse Prevention Orders, is a legal measure designed to protect elderly or dependent adults residing in Norwalk, California from various forms of abuse. These restraining orders provide a safeguard against physical, financial, emotional, or sexual abuse, as well as neglect by caregivers or other individuals. To initiate the process, the victim or their representative must file a Request for Elder or Dependent Adult Abuse Restraining Order at the Norwalk Superior Court. The court recognizes different types of abuse prevention orders, depending on the specific circumstances: 1. Emergency Protective Orders (EPO): In cases of immediate danger and when time is of the essence, victims can request an Emergency Protective Order. This order is available 24/7 and can be obtained from law enforcement agencies, including the local police department or sheriff's office. EPOS provides immediate protection but are temporary, usually lasting up to seven days. 2. Temporary Restraining Orders (TO): Once the emergency situation is addressed, victims can apply for a Temporary Restraining Order. These orders typically last up to 25 days and can be granted after a hearing where the judge evaluates the evidence and determines the need for ongoing protection. 3. Permanent Restraining Orders (PRO): If the abuse and threat require long-term protection, victims can request a Permanent Restraining Order. An investigation process and subsequent court hearing are necessary to determine the ongoing need for protection. PRO scan be issued for up to five years, and in some cases, for an indefinite duration. The request for a Norwalk California Elder or Dependent Adult Abuse Restraining Order involves filling out a comprehensive form, which includes detailed descriptions of the abuse, information about the victim and the alleged abuser(s). It is crucial to provide accurate information and evidence to support the claims of abuse. Victims can also seek assistance from various resources, such as local law enforcement agencies, legal aid organizations, or non-profit organizations specializing in elder or dependent adult abuse prevention. It is essential to remember that Norwalk California provides these restraining orders to ensure the safety and well-being of elderly or dependent adults facing abuse. By filing a request for an Elder or Dependent Adult Abuse Restraining Order, victims and their representatives take a crucial step towards protecting themselves or their loved ones from any form of harm or mistreatment.
